Complement C3aR signaling: Immune and metabolic modulation and its impact on Alzheimer's disease

Manasee Gedam,
Hui Zheng

Abstract: Alzheimer's disease (AD) is a progressive neurodegenerative disorder and the most common cause of dementia among the elderly population. Despite its widespread prevalence, our comprehension of the intricate mechanisms governing the pathogenesis of the disease remains incomplete, posing a challenge for the development of efficient therapies.
